Alfred Lam

Alfred Lam MBBS, MD, FRCPA, FRCPath, FIAC, PhD.
Griffith Health Institute, Griffith University, Gold Coast.

Bio:
Professor Alfred Lam is a senior visiting specialist pathologist in Pathology Queensland and provides a referral consultancy service to Australia and overseas. He is also Head of Pathology in Griffith Medical School and Head of Cancer Research Center in Griffith Health Institute. Alfred has contributed to the development of pathology curriculum in a number of medical schools. Currently, he is the Assistant Chief Examiner for the Royal College of Pathologists of Australia. His central research focus is on molecular pathology of human cancers, particularly thyroid, head/neck/oral/esophageal, adrenal and colorectal cancers. A regularly invited speaker at international conferences, Alfred has also extensive collaborations with cancer centers in Asia-Pacific region. He is an invited author for the World Health Organization (WHO) book on endocrine tumor pathology. Also, he is the lead author for the thyroid cancer and adrenal cancer structural pathology reporting protocol for the Royal College of Pathologists of Australasia. In addition, he has produced over 250 peer-reviewed publications. The citation index of his publications (H index) is 38 which is an excellent indicator commensurate with his career stage. Professor Lam was the winner of the best senior researcher by Griffith University’s Vice Chancellor in 2011 and clinical researcher award of Australian society of medical research Queensland award in 2013.
